Current Wendy's menu pricing for chicken sandwiches
Wendy's menu pricing for chicken sandwiches has evolved, reflecting broader trends in fast food economics. As of recent updates, the classic 2 for $5 deal on chicken sandwiches is no longer universally available. Instead, Wendy's has shifted to a more dynamic pricing strategy, offering promotions that vary by location and time. For instance, some regions still feature a 2 for $6 deal, while others have introduced bundle options that include sides and drinks at a slightly higher price point. This variability underscores the importance of checking local Wendy's menus or their app for the most accurate and current deals.
Analyzing the pricing structure reveals Wendy's strategic approach to balancing affordability and profitability. The brand has introduced premium chicken sandwich options, such as the Spicy Chicken Sandwich or the Pretzel Bacon Pub Chicken Sandwich, which are priced higher than the classic offerings. These premium items cater to customers willing to pay more for enhanced flavors and ingredients, while the traditional sandwiches remain a budget-friendly option. This tiered pricing model allows Wendy's to appeal to a broader customer base, from value-conscious diners to those seeking a more indulgent experience.

As of the most recent updates, Wendy's no longer offers the 2 for $5 deal on their chicken sandwiches. Pricing may vary by location, so it’s best to check with your local Wendy’s for current promotions.
Wendy's frequently updates its menu and promotions based on market conditions, ingredient costs, and customer preferences. The 2 for $5 deal was likely discontinued to make way for new offers or to adjust pricing strategies.
Wendy's often runs limited-time promotions or regional deals. Check the Wendy's app, website, or your local restaurant for the latest offers on chicken sandwiches or other menu items.
